• New Director for Chillventa and European Heat Pump Summit

The management of the trade fair Chillventa and the European Heat Pump Summit will be taken over by Alexander Stein (40) starting November 1, 2013. He succeeds the event manager Gabriele Hannwacker, who is retiring after a 35-year career as an organizer and more than 25 years of service in the refrigeration and air conditioning industry. Stein brings a wealth of experience from 16 years in the trade fair business. In the interview, the two trade fair experts discuss their joint plans for the two events and talk about the highlights of the European Heat Pump Summit, which will enter its third edition on October 15 and 16, 2013, at the Nuremberg Exhibition Center.

"Mr. Stein, you studied Business Administration with a focus on environmentally oriented corporate management and subsequently co-developed trade fairs for Nuremberg Messe. Most recently, you worked in the event team for BIOFACH, the world’s leading trade fair for organic food. From which perspective do you view the connection between economy and ecology for the heat pump?"

Alexander Stein:
"Efficiency and energy savings are also crucial in refrigeration, air conditioning, ventilation, and heat pumps. However, the contribution of these industries goes far beyond that, especially when it comes to the heat pump: it not only helps reduce CO2 emissions but also plays a role in the energy transition, including the use of renewable energies. For example, I think of the combination of direct use of solar power for the heat pump."

"Chillventa and the European Heat Pump Summit provide the industry with an annual platform to exchange ideas on innovations and markets. Ms. Hannwacker, what role does the heat pump play for the Nuremberg trade fair location?"

Gabriele Hannwacker:
"Since 2008, Chillventa has been the meeting point for international experts on refrigeration, air conditioning, ventilation, and heat pumps. From the very beginning, the heat pump has been prominently represented at Chillventa. Since 2009, the European Heat Pump Summit has expanded the information offering for heat pump experts during the years between Chillventa editions. As a congress event with an accompanying foyer expo, the European Heat Pump Summit brings together planners and operators, science and research, as well as manufacturers of heat pumps and components. Environmental compatibility, resource conservation, and sustainability – in all these aspects, the heat pump can demonstrate an excellent balance. We are committed to helping the heat pump gain the recognition it deserves."

"What can participants expect at the European Heat Pump Summit 2013?"

Alexander Stein:
"The range of topics extends from components and systems to market analyses on an international level. The agenda also includes discussions on challenges faced by heat pump providers, such as smart grids, and updates on the latest international research and development. We are supported by numerous partners, especially Dr. Rainer Jakobs, who, as coordinator of the European Heat Pump Summit, contributes significantly to the event's success with professional advice and industry expertise. The program no longer attracts only European participants; professionals from other continents also use the European Heat Pump Summit as an information platform."

Gabriele Hannwacker:
"With the European Heat Pump Summit, we offer a transnational congress where professionals can exchange ideas at a high level. The motto here is 'by experts, for experts.' Topics include the development of the European, Russian, and Indian heat pump markets, the importance of the 20-20-20 targets of the European Union, optimization potentials in components and heat pumps, as well as practical reports from the field. These are just some of the topics participants can look forward to."

The topics of the European Heat Pump Summit 2013 are:

• Use of renewable energies with heat pumps
• Market potentials for heat pumps
• Components and product development
• Practical reports on the use of residential, commercial, and industrial heat pumps
• Heat pumps for hot water preparation
• Technical innovations and perspectives for the heat pump
• Heat pump as an important building block for Germany’s energy transition

Foyer Expo: Technical discussions on heat pump technology
The accompanying foyer expo offers heat pump and component manufacturers a dedicated platform to showcase technical innovations and current products. Located close to the congress activities, the exhibition provides the best conditions for technical dialogue among manufacturers, experts from science and research, planners, and operators.
